POMPANO BEACH, FL (Boca Post) (Copyright © 2024) — A tragic incident occurred in Pompano Beach where a man lost his life after being hit by a Tri Rail train. The Broward Sheriff’s Office Homicide Unit is currently investigating the details surrounding this event that took place on Thursday night. Authorities were alerted to the collision between the pedestrian and the train near Northwest 13th Avenue and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Boulevard in Pompano Beach just before 11 p.m. Eyewitnesses reported that the man, whose identity remains undisclosed, walked onto the tracks from east to west and turned towards the approaching train before being struck by it. Despite efforts from emergency responders, the man was pronounced dead at the scene. The Broward Sheriff’s Office deployed crime scene and homicide detectives to conduct a thorough investigation into this tragic incident.

The pedestrian’s remains were taken to the Broward County Medical Examiner’s Office for further examination. There is currently no suspicion of any criminal activity. The inquiry is still ongoing.
